What Makes a Live Casino Worth Your Time?

First, the reliability of the stream. A jittery feed is a waste of seconds you could be betting. Second, the professionalism of the dealer. A half‑asleep presenter will ruin the illusion faster than a mis‑aligned slot reel.

Third, the bonus structure. Most operators throw a “gift” of a few free spins or a modest deposit match at you, but the fine print reveals a maze of wagering requirements that would make a tax accountant weep. Nobody hands out “free” money; it’s a loan you’ll never fully repay.

Finally, the withdrawal process. A drawn‑out withdrawal is the digital equivalent of a slow‑moving snare. You’ve earned your winnings, but you’ll be waiting longer than a slot’s bonus round to see them hit your account.

Unlike the high‑variance thrill of Gonzo’s Quest, where a single spin can turn your balance upside‑down, live tables tend to flatten the peaks. The variance is lower, the house edge is steady, and the emotional roller‑coaster is replaced by a polite, measured exchange.
